## Artifact Signing — Quellbrook Queue Compaction

The Quellbrook broker runs log compaction nightly on the `orders-events` topic. Compacted segments are re-bundled into snapshot artifacts, and each artifact must be signed before the replay tooling will accept it. If you're on call and compaction stalls, check disk headroom on the broker nodes first, then re-run the `qb-compact sign` step manually. The signer verifies against the team's published key, shown below for convenience.

signing key of bagap-yawep = bky13_TbfT6ZMUoGJo2

## Migration Step 4: Deduplicate Customer Records

Before importing into Fernhollow CRM, run the dedupe pass on the legacy export. The matcher compares normalized email, surname, and postal region, and flags ambiguous pairs for manual review rather than auto-merging. Do not lower the confidence threshold without sign-off from the data lead, as earlier trials produced false merges. The dedupe job reads its thresholds and match rules from the configuration block below.

service settings:
HOLDOR_PIN=6477
HOLDOR_METRICS_HOST=metrics.holdor.nelvrocorp.corp
HOLDOR_LOG_LEVEL=error
HOLDOR_TENANT=noviel

Onboarding note for the Ledgerpane admin table: bulk edits are applied through the batcher service, not directly against the database. Select rows, choose an action, and the batcher stages changes in a pending set you can review before commit. Edits over 500 rows require a second approver — this is enforced server-side, so don't try to chunk around it. To run the batcher locally you need the staging write credential, which goes in your .env as the next line.

secret setting of bahip-kagag: RELAY_SECRET3=c83